What Are Androgenic Effects?
Androgenic effects are those that are primarily related to the development of male characteristics. These effects can include:
- Increased facial and body hair.
- Acne and oily skin.
- Deepening of the voice.
- Male pattern baldness.
Examples of Less Androgenic Steroids
When looking for steroids with lower androgenic effects, consider the following options:
- Oxandrolone (Anavar): Known for its mild nature and lower androgenic rating, Anavar is popular among athletes and bodybuilders seeking gradual muscle gains without significant side effects.
- Stanozolol (Winstrol): Although it carries some androgenic properties, its effects can be dampened when used in a cycle with other compounds, making it a viable option for cutting phases.
- Boldenone Undecylenate (Equipoise): This steroid has a moderate androgenic rating and tends to produce fewer side effects compared to others, offering a balance between muscle growth and safety.
- Nandrolone (Deca-Durabolin): Nandrolone is known for its ability to promote muscle growth with fewer androgenic effects, making it a staple in many bodybuilding cycles.
